The story so far
Higher revenues accrue to producers, whereas consumers confront steeper costs at the pump. Bloomberg reports hedge funds lifted bullish oil positions to their highest level since May as the Iran war escalated, while Reuters notes the market is on track for its steepest weekly gain since mid‑July. The Wall Street Journal links the rally to a conflict expected to linger, and Semafor points to renewed U.S. sanctions on Iran as a price driver.
Axios observes that markets can no longer sideline the conflict, underscoring heightened risk perception. Coverage varies on the diesel outlook; none of the pieces provide detailed inventory data, and estimates of how long the premium will hold differ. Reports stop short of quantifying the sanctions’ effect on global supply chains, leaving uncertainty over the conflict’s duration and the potential for further market shifts.
No outlet provides forecasts for diesel, and the extent of U.S. sanction enforcement remains unquantified.

The obvious questions
Why have oil prices risen sharply in early September 2026?
Oil prices have climbed as hedge funds raised bullish bets, U.S.-Iran tensions intensified, and renewed U.S. sanctions on Iran have added a war premium, according to Bloomberg, Reuters, the Wall Street Journal and Semafor.
Which market participants are most affected by the current rally?
Oil‑producing nations and energy traders stand to gain higher revenues, while refiners, airlines and other fuel‑intensive users face higher input costs.
What information is still missing from the reporting on the oil and diesel surge?
Detailed diesel inventory figures, forecasts for diesel pricing, and quantification of how U.S. sanctions will affect global supply chains are not provided in the current articles.
